Reporting to the Program Manager, the Clinical Lab Assistant (CLA) is responsible for providing community pharmacy instructional support, facility supervision and maintenance, test invigilation, marking objective assessments, and general program area administrative tasks under the directions of the Program Manager or designate. The CLA assists in supporting students’ independent learning, facilitates the inclusion of students in learning opportunities and encourages students to become independent learners and members of the classroom, school, and community. The CLA assists faculty in providing opportunities for student success. The Clinical Lab Assistant will be responsible for supporting community pharmacy laboratory simulation and other learning activities for the Pharmacy Technician Program.

Responsibilities include but are not limited to:

Under the direction of the instructor, and/or Pharmacy Technician Program Lead, support the course delivery, and re-demonstrate community pharmacy laboratory, simulation and other learning activities.Under the direction of the instructor, provide practice/remedial supports to students on a small group or individual basis.Under the supervision of the program instructor, invigilate exams and provide assessment support.As directed by instructor, prepare classroom and simulation lab equipment, supplies, and other learning materials for various learning activities. Oversee lab activities during scheduled clinical practice time and provides feedback and corrections as required.Maintain and clean/sterilize lab equipment, arrange equipment repairs and laundering services, and manage the inventory and supply orders, involving students as relevant to learning activities.Ensure a safe work environment by complying with WHMIS regulations, reinforcing safe patient handling protocols, and adhering to lab rules and other MITT policy and procedures.Reinforce MITT and program policies to students.Foster a co-operative, respectful working relationship with the instructor and work within the parameters of this position.

Required Qualifications and Experience:

A combination of related education and experience may be considered.

A certificate or diploma from an accredited Pharmacy Technician Program - Must maintain currency of practice. Listed as pharmacy technician (RPEBC-PT) with the College of Pharmacists of Manitoba (CPhM).Certificate in Adult Education is considered an asset. 1- 3 years of community pharmacy practice work experience.Compliance with all relevant CCAPP standards, NAPRA competencies, CPTEA educational outcomes, and associated legislation.
